Sri Lankan President Urges Rebels to Lay Down Arms


(6 April 09-RV) Sri Lanka's president appealed to cornered Tamil Tiger rebels today to lay down their arms and surrender to save their lives and ensure the safety of tens of thousands of civilians trapped with them in a «no-fire» zone. The appeal from President Mahinda Rajapaksa came as the military increased the rebel death toll to at least 453 dead from three days of battles.
